What is EEPROM?

The EEPROM is a non-volatile memory chip which can be erased and changed. It can be used to store a variety of things, such as serial numbers and other unique information, in almost every device connected to Ethernet. It is the chip found in charge cards and printers and blood sugar monitors. It can also be used to store data that regulates microcontrollers' operation and also as a way to recover from power-on resets.

The fundamental EEPROM chip contains two field effect transistors. One of them is a floating gate, and the other is a control gate. When the device is powered with electricity, electrons are released from the gate and may be held in either one or zero state depending on how much voltage is applied. The EEPROM can be read by determining the state of these transistors.

When the EEPROM is in the "0" state it is in no use. When the EEPROM state is "1" it has a value of 1. In between these states, there is no stored data, however it can be written to. EEPROMs can be erased by the short duration of the voltage applied to the gate.

The benefit of EEPROM is that it can be written to and erased without the need for any external circuitry. This makes it extremely useful for systems that needs to be regularly updated like remote keyless system microcontrollers. However there are different memory chip types that offer similar capabilities and are better suited for long-term storage and retrieval of large files.

Modern flash memory chips are a common feature in digital cameras and computers. They are typically used to store multimedia files to be used for short-term as well as long-term storage and retrieval. Nevertheless, they are not considered to be true EEPROMs and their primary functions are different from those of true EEPROMs. EEPROMs are still extensively used, but because of their versatility and capacity to store a limited amount of data in a small space.

What is OBDII?

Until recently the majority of car manufacturers had their own methods to identify problems with vehicles. Then in 1996, the government mandated that all vehicles have an established system to read diagnostic codes. This new system, called OBD-II, uses the same port and diagnostic code system across all makes and models of vehicles that are sold in the US. This means that if you encounter a problem with your car it will be simple for any mechanic to pinpoint what is causing the issue by plugging in a specialized tool.

The OBD-II reads a variety of issues within the engine and other parts with the standard diagnostic plug. The information is stored in the car's computer for later analysis. This lets the system detect and repair any faults before they cause major damage. The mechanic can connect an OBD-II scan tool to the port that will display error codes and indicate where they originated.

Scan tools have a higher processing capacity than code readers and are able to read more types of error codes. They can also display live data graphs, and save data for later analysis. Some tools are capable of performing advanced functions such as changing the code of an ECU or offering options to improve performance. These tools are utilized by auto technicians who are professionals and are generally more expensive than simple scanners.

When connecting a scan tool to the OBD-II port, it will automatically recognize what protocol it is using, and communicate with the vehicle by using the correct pins. There are a variety of protocols that are used, but the most popular ones are SAE J1850 which is utilized in Ford and a few GM vehicles, ISO 14230-4 (KWP2000) that is used in a variety of European or Asian vehicles and CAN, which is used in the majority of American-made vehicles. Some scan tools will even tell you what the code means, while others will only give you the code and will require an internet search to find out what it means.

What is CAS unit?

The CAS module is an BMW module that regulates the car's antitheft system. The system works by reading an encoded signal from the key fob and confirming it with the CAS module. The CAS module will send an enable signal to the engine control unit if the signal is valid. If it's not the signal is valid, the engine will not start.

BMW CAS module failures could cause a variety of issues including key fob problems and central locking, alarm activation and dashboard warning lights. If you're experiencing any of these symptoms, it's crucial to have the CAS module inspected by a professional as soon as possible.

The CAS system communicates with the vehicle's engine and other systems via the BMW ICOM VCDS. The VCDS is connected to the CAS by an extra cable that has an DIN connector at the end. The VCDS can perform a variety of functions that include displaying error codes and altering the timing of the ignition. It also offers a variety of security features that shield the vehicle from theft.

In addition to the ICOM VCDS, BMW vehicles come with a CAS component that is integrated into the key. The CAS module does not use batteries and is powered by the ignition coil. A transponder chip is embedded in the key to send the encoded signal to the CAS module. This is transmitted through an antenna loop (coil) at the lock for ignition.

How do you program a BMW key

BMW offers drivers in the Murrieta area with keyless entry, a convenient feature that allows you to lock and unlock your vehicle without the need for keys that are physically present. However the keyless entry feature is only activated when the key fob is programmed to the vehicle. It's only a couple of simple steps.

cropped-KeyLab-1-152x69.pngThe process is slightly different dependent on whether you're pairing a brand new BMW key fob to your existing BMW or if you are starting from scratch without a working BMW key. First, you must put the working key fob in your vehicle and then insert the one you'd like to program. Make sure all the doors and windows are closed. Insert the working key into the ignition, and turn it to the first position and return it quickly five times (do not start the engine). Turn the key back again and then take it out.

Hold the unlock button while pressing the lock button (the BMW Logo) three times quickly. Then, release the unlock diamond button on bmw Key, and the door locks will lock and unlock automatically. Repeat this procedure for each additional key fob you wish to program.

The final step is connecting your smartphone to your vehicle via Bluetooth. Start the BMW Connected app and log in. The BMW Digital Key setup button will be displayed. This will activate the key on your smartphone and allow you to use it with the Digital Wallet app.
